Is Ensure Clear a Protein Drink?

4 min read

Each 10 fl oz serving of Ensure Clear provides 8 grams of high-quality protein from whey protein isolate. This confirms that Ensure Clear is a protein drink, although it is specifically designed for certain nutritional purposes rather than for high-protein muscle building.

The Answer: Is Ensure Clear a Protein Drink?

Yes, Ensure Clear is classified as a protein drink. While it may not contain the high protein content of a shake designed for bodybuilders, each serving delivers a moderate 8 grams of high-quality whey protein isolate. The important distinction to understand is its specific purpose and application. Unlike traditional creamy protein shakes, Ensure Clear is a fat-free, fruit-flavored liquid intended for individuals who need nutritional support but cannot tolerate a milky or thick supplement. This makes it a protein source, but with a highly specific therapeutic use case.

The Nutritional Profile of Ensure Clear

To fully understand its role, a deeper look at the nutrition label is necessary. Beyond the 8 grams of protein, a standard 10 fl oz serving of Ensure Clear provides 180 calories and is fortified with 15 essential vitamins and minerals. Its key ingredients include water, corn maltodextrin, sugar, and whey protein isolate.

  • Protein Source: The protein in Ensure Clear comes from whey protein isolate, a high-quality, easily digestible form of milk protein.
  • Fat-Free: Its fat-free composition is a crucial feature, making it suitable for clear liquid diets and fat-restricted diets.
  • High in Sugar: It contains a significant amount of sugar, including 18 grams of added sugars per 10 fl oz serving. This provides energy but is a key difference when comparing it to low-sugar protein drinks.

Intended Use Cases and Considerations

Ensure Clear serves a specific segment of the nutritional supplement market. It is often recommended in clinical settings and for individuals with particular dietary needs. Some of its common applications include:

  • Pre- and Post-Surgical Nutrition: Its clear liquid nature is gentle on the digestive system, making it an excellent option before and after certain surgical procedures.
  • Clear Liquid Diets: It is a staple for those on a clear liquid diet, such as during preparation for a colonoscopy, as it provides nutrients without leaving residue.
  • Fat-Restricted Diets: For patients with fat malabsorption issues or those on a fat-restricted diet, Ensure Clear provides a source of protein and calories without fat content.
  • Alternative to Creamy Shakes: For individuals who prefer or need a lighter, fruit-flavored alternative to creamy, milk-based nutritional shakes, Ensure Clear offers a palatable option.

Comparison Table: Ensure Clear vs. Other Drinks

To highlight the differences between Ensure Clear and other protein and nutritional drinks, the table below provides a side-by-side comparison. The table includes Ensure Max Protein, a high-protein option from the same brand, and a typical third-party clear whey isolate product.

Feature Ensure Clear Ensure Max Protein Clear Whey Isolate (e.g., Isopure)
Protein (per serving) 8g 30g 20-25g
Calories (per serving) 180 (10 fl oz) 150 (11 fl oz) ~100 (varies by brand)
Fat (per serving) 0g 1.5g 0g
Carbs (per serving) 37g 5g 3g
Sugar (per serving) 18g (added) 1g 0g
Texture/Flavor Light, juice-like, fruit flavors Creamy shake, various flavors Light, juice-like, fruit flavors
Best For Clear liquid diets, therapeutic use High-protein muscle support, low sugar High-protein intake, low carb/sugar

Pros and Cons of Ensure Clear

Pros:

  • Refreshing Alternative: The fruit flavors and juice-like texture offer a welcome change for those tired of creamy shakes.
  • Fat-Free: With 0 grams of fat, it is ideal for specific dietary restrictions and medical conditions.
  • Moderately Nutritious: Provides a moderate amount of protein alongside essential vitamins and minerals.
  • Clear Liquid Diet Approved: Its clear formulation is a key benefit for individuals preparing for medical procedures.
  • Allergen-Friendly: It is gluten-free and suitable for people with lactose intolerance.

Cons:

  • High in Sugar: Contains a notable amount of added sugars, which may not be suitable for all diets.
  • Not a Complete Meal Replacement: Due to its lack of fat, it is not considered a complete meal and should only be used as a supplement.
  • Lower Protein: The 8g protein count is significantly lower than many dedicated protein supplements.
